Europeans-Chinese Suck up Stimulus $

on Saturday, 19 December 2009.

Why are we Stimulating Europe's & China's Economy? Because we have been so slow adopting alternative energies, Chinese and European companies have been sucking up all of the stimulus money being spent on wind power generating technology. The same can be said for solar power. In Arizona alone two new solar farms are in the works with the equipment coming from China...


These funds should have had strings attached requiring the equipment to come from the US. There are US companies, like GE, making this wind turbines and solar collectors. Instead, jobs were created in Germany, France and China.

I applaud the stimulus in so far as it helped our companies and our people.  But why  we should give it to other countries is baffling. Acting in haste to get the economy back on track seemed a good thing. But to act without thinking through the consequences is unconscionable.

Friedman Has the Right Attitude

on Thursday, 10 December 2009.

Thomas Friedman, author of Hot, Flat, and Crowded has it right. His attitude toward global warming deniers makes sense to me. His position is that we should react to events of low probability but with high impact in the same way we react to the low probability of Al-Qaida obtaining an atomic bomb, which would have a very high impact should it happen...
